Data Science & Security for Mobility Assignment 1: Analyzing Taxi Trips in Chicago (Mon 26/10/2020) In this assignment you will analyze taxi trip data from Chicago for 2020: • The assignment consists of building a Jupyter notebook that analyses the data as described below. • The assignment is to be completed in groups. Each group should have a minimum of 3 and maximum of 4 students. (Ideally groups should consist of students from the same lecture group, but that is not a requirement.) • The due date for the assignment is midnight on Tuesday the 17th of November (via BEEP). On Wednesday the 18th or Thursday the 19th of November, your group will need to present your notebook during the practical session. The assignment makes use of publicly available data from the City of Chicago and the National Oceanic and Atmospheric Administration (NOAA): 1. Anonymised taxi trip information for over 3 million trips performed in 2020 was been downloaded from: https://data.cityofchicago.org/Transportation/Taxi-Trips-2020/r2u4-wwk3 Note that full dataset for 2020 is 1.5 GB uncompressed, so we have sampled 10% of the data and provided it on BEEP. If you wish to use the full dataset instead, you can. (Just download it by clicking on the export button). Note also the description of the various fields in the data provided on the website. 2. Daily weather data for Chicago O’Hare airport has been sourced from NOAA: https://www.ncdc.noaa.gov/cdo-web/search The assignment requires you to visualize various aspects of the data and build predictive models with it. The tasks listed below are suggestions for some basic analysis that your group could perform. You are strongly encouraged to investigate further the data and present all your insights in your notebook. 1) Data Visualization Show some…
